Transaction 6bec17d2e8486fbe8b86ba4c28ad8aa34fa3f6496758957e1f919225f4049fde
1 Input
1 Output
-
6bec17d2e8486fbe8b86ba4c28ad8aa34fa3f6496758957e1f919225f4049fde:0
- value
- 1320633
- script pubkey
- OP_0 OP_PUSHBYTES_20 768477a5294ef86b0d947dd7eac6d183759c8249
- address
- bc1qw6z80ffffmuxkrv50ht743k3sd6eeqjfrcxcnq